(AU setting in which Emma Swan is a criminal private investigator. Her life takes a turn when her boss tells her she must now work with a man named Killian Jones who doesn't even have a clue what a private investigator does.)

Emma Swan rushed into the kitchen grabbing her thermos. She went into the fridge and quickly took out the lunch she had prepared the day before plus an apple and stuffed it in her bag. She scanned the large apartment making sure she hadn't forgotten anything and noticed the folder on the coffee table.

"Dammit. Almost forgot that."

She ran to get it, grabbed her car keys hanging near the door and shut the door behind her.

Emma didn't usually wake up late, but she was up all night putting the finishing touches on her project proposal for her boss so she slept through her alarm. Emma paid no attention to speed limits hoping she would not be stopped by a cop. She could not be late today.

At 7:56 she was rushing into the building.

"Just in time." She whispered, proud that she was able to make it before 8:00.

She ran up the stairs instead of waiting for the elevator, placed her stuff on her desk and quickly walked into conference room her folder in hand.

"Emma! I knew you wouldn't be late," her boss exclaimed as soon as she walked through the door.

Emma nodded. "Couldn't miss such an important meeting." She took a seat next to her coworkers.

Robert Jones, her boss, was a nice man who cared a lot about work production. That is why he liked Emma so much. Out of all her coworkers she had been the one to solve the most cases in the past year. If you asked anyone else working in the company they probably might tell you that Robert Jones liked Emma like a daughter. He trusted Emma with the toughest and delicate cases and Emma had never let him down. For this reason, Emma was 100 percent positive that the folder in her hand would please him.

Mr. Jones had asked all his employees to come up with an innovative idea that would improve the company. He had given them all a month, but Emma had already been planning an idea long before that. Four months of coffee driven late nights laid in the folder in front of her. Today was going to show all her coworkers that she did deserve all the praise given to her by Mr.Jones. This was her chance to show them of the greater things she could achieve. 

Mr.Jones took a seat and started talking again. "Well now that we're all here, it's time to make an announcement. As you know I have asked you all to come up with an idea to bring something new to this company. We've gathered all here to share our ideas, but there's been a change of plans."

Emma panicked. She hated when there was change especially when she didn't expect it.

"I realized that I'm getting very old and that means that I can't run this company forever, but I do hope to keep it within the family. That is why today I'd like to introduce you all to my son." He signaled towards the door behind him.

"Killian, come in."

Through the door walked in a dark haired man, blue eyes and a stubble beard. The first thing that Emma noticed were his dark clothes. Black dress shirt, leather jacket, black jeans and black dress shoes. Emma didn't know Mr. Jones had a son. Mr. Jones never mentioned him, not that he said much about his private life and Killian had never been at any of the companies parties or social gatherings. This man certainly looked nothing like, Mr. Jones. Instead of Mr. Jones' kind eyes this man had fierce eyes and instead of a welcoming smile he had a forced smile and a smug look.

"Hello everyone." Killian greeted with an accent as his eyes darted across the conference room. He didn't look happy to be here.

Mr. Jones put his arm around his son. "Killian here will be sort of like your vice president. He has no experience yet, but in good time I'm sure he'll learn everything he needs to know about Jones and Co. Here's the even most exciting part. After he's got everything under control he will be picking one of the ideas that you have brought with you today."
